MATLAB与STK互联1:建立STK场景并保存
STK是功能非常强大的系统仿真软件,可以对航天器、航空器、导弹、火箭、船舶、车辆等进行仿真分析。
MATLAB与STK互联,主要有两种方式,一种是connect、一种是com口。
这里主要介绍com口形式,要比connect连接简单一些。
在MATLAB命令窗口(或新建.m文件)输入以下命令:
%我这里就的STK是V11版本,这里改成自己STK的版本号
uiapplication = actxserver(‘STK11.application’);
%输入下条命令,可以显示STK没有场景的状态。可以不输入,后面建立场景自然会显示STK
uiapplication.Visible = 1;
%root是我们以后操作场景以及场景中对象的源头
root = uiapplication.Personality2;
%新建场景。
root.NewScenario(‘scnew’);
%保存场景
%如果,第一次保存该场景。该条命令将场景保存在STK场景默认根目录下
%如果,是在加载的场景中使用该命令,将场景保存在该场景的原目录下
root.Save()
%将场景保存在指定目录下,同时可以将场景重新命名
root.SaveScenarioAs(‘C:\Users\lty15\Documents\STK 11 (x64)\exam\exam’);
%关闭当前场景
root.CloseScenario;
%加载已建立的场景
root.LoadScenario(‘C:\Users\lty15\Documents\STK 11 (x64)\exam\exam.sc’)
上述内容是建立场景、保存场景的基本命令。
PS:如有不准确的地方请提出指正。
MATLAB与STK互联1:建立STK场景并保存相关推荐
- MATLAB与STK互联46:在场景中加入某个国家作为Area Target对象(GIS命令使用)
在很多分析场景中,我们会插入某个国家国土区域作为分析对象.比如设计陆地资源遥感卫星时,分析对我国任意一点的重访时间,这时就需要插入我国的国土区域.在STK中,提供了插入某个国家的功能.当然如果你手上有 ...
- MATLAB与STK互联45:STK软件仿真视频录制
应用STK进行任务仿真,除了计算数据之外,还有一个重要功能,就是场景展示,虽然STK效果比不专业的动画软件.这就涉及到,视频录制的问题了. STK软件自带了视频录制功能,2D.3D都可以录制.这里以3 ...
- MATLAB与STK互联1:建立STK场景并保存(补丁)
在上一篇文章中,无需提前打开STK.输入actxserver('STK11.application')命令后,将自动启动STK软件. 如果STK已打开,则使用actxGetRunningServer( ...
- matlab与STK互联(不使用connect软件的互联)
版本说明: matlab使用2014a:STK使用STK9 1. 安装MATLAB与STK (1)STK9百度网盘文件: https://pan.baidu.com/s/1W9UufFPS4KzeeF ...
- 关于Matlab与STK互联问题
关于Matlab与STK互联问题 由于近期需要用到Matlab和STK进行联合仿真,因此在两个软件的互联上绕了很多弯路,最终成功实现了STK10与Matlab2012a(32位)之间的互联. 两个软件 ...
- MATLAB与STK互联47:卫星在轨寿命分析(lifetime)
当我们设计卫星轨道时,轨道高度不能太低,以避免卫星快速的进入大气层烧毁.那怎么分析卫星在轨寿命呢,STK软件提供了寿命计算功能,本文就对这个功能进行介绍.先手动操作一遍,然后再利用MATLAB与STK ...
- PreScan 教程:1. 建立新场景
PreScan 1:建立新场景 写在前面 新建场景 PreScan GUI中设置 Matlab中设置 写在前面 安装完PreScan 桌面一下多出许多图标,可能看着很乱,可以只保留 PreScan G ...
- 基于Matlab在以地球为中心的场景中模拟和跟踪航路飞机仿真(附源码)
目录 一.创建航路空中交通方案 二.定义飞机模型和轨迹 三.沿路线添加监控站 四.可视化场景 五.定义中央雷达跟踪器和跟踪热熔器 六.使用雷达和 ADS-B 跟踪飞行 七.分析结果 八.总结 九.程序 ...
- matlab传函零极点形式,2013实验一 MATLAB 中控制系统模型的建立与仿真
实验一 MATLAB 中控制系统模型的建立与仿真 一. 实验目的 (1)熟悉MATLAB 控制系统工具箱中线性控制系统传递函数模型的相关函数. (2)熟悉SIMULINK 模块库,能够使用SIMULI ...
最新文章
- PCB多层线路板打样难点
- 中科院大牛带你玩转Python数据分析,大厂offer轻松拿!
- 数据分析与挖掘实战-窃电漏电用户的发现
- 通过代码解决SharePoint列表视图权限分配问题
- 大津二值化算法 ( Otsu's binarization ) 自动确定二值化图像时的阈值
- 如何用python计算圆周率_使用MicroPython计算任意位数圆周率
- 在RStudio中调用python包
- 安装Office时提示error 1706错误解决办法
- 康复期需注意什么?一组手账告诉你
- props写法_vue props default Array或是Object的正确写法说明
- android:RecyclerView交互动画(上下拖动,左右滑动删除)
- 华为nova5z和nova5i 哪个好?有什么区别?
- Bridging the Gap between Training and Inference for Neural Machine Translation翻译
- java ide的配置(idea)
- 流式检测巨噬细胞方法
- 未来趋势:区块链溯源技术
- 解决了计算机处理汉字的问题,计算机处理汉字必须解决的三个问题分别是汉字...
- apidoc使用教程-编写漂亮的api文档
- 《ffmpeg入门学习》 二 摄像头对接
- Linux永久修改主机名